Specification of Geosynchronous Plasma Environment.

Abstract

Data from UCSD plasma instruments on the ATS 5 and 6 satellites has been studied to specify the geosynchronous plasma environment as it affects electrostatic charging of spacecraft. The emphasis of the initial study has been primarily to service the needs of the design engineer; while simultaneously establishing the context in which a more general model could be developed. The report includes an environmental specification plus a review of geosynchronous plasma and wave phenomena. (Author)
